As deemed by Mashable, National Social Media Day was this Thursday, June 30th, and to celebrate this joyous holiday we did a live broadcast!

Detroit partied hard this year for Social Media Day by throwing the bash of the century at Motor City Casino & Hotel, which is where we streamed live from.

Motor City Casino and Livio Radio teamed up to throw and awesome party which included giveaways, sponsor/vendor booths with free swag, suprise Skype-ins, DJs, $2 drafts, biggest group jump Instagram picture and free food--including a build-your-own-coney station!

But most importantly, GIRLY NERDY GOODNESS BROADCASTED LIVE FROM THE EVENT by Katelyn and Jordan!

We were reserved a table in which we could bring in our whole set up and broadcast live, via Livestream, our show!

We had an incredible list of guest speakers and topics that made our show completely awesome!

  • Peter Jurich, local Detroit author, journalist and reverend, joined us to discuss his theory on the death of social networking.
  • Hannah Sarnacki, Youth Football Assistant with the Detroit Lions, and Kristen Antioho, an intern at Pro Camps Worldwide, discussed the relationship between social media and sports.
  • Myke Carmody, local rapper, discussed social media marketing, branding yourself and the value of the internet.
  • Open Discussion: Job Hunting via Social Media; How to Brand Yourself; Public vs Private Profiles

The show went off without at hitch, except for the poor lighting, and we couldn't be happier!

As you may have heard, Katelyn and Whitney had been collecting pledges for a Michigan Special Olympics fundraiser--The Polar Plunge. After raising over $700 in donations the day came for them to actually jump into the frozen river and show their support.

On February 19th, D-Day, it was 35° F in Detroit, Michigan and the water temperature was a chilly 37° F below 11 inches of ice.  Let the video speak for itself...
